Position Responsibilities
The successful candidate will be a key contributor to a team which manages a broad portfolio of fixed income assets and derivative products.
This is a front-office, buy-side position within the investment management arm of PNC’s bank portfolio (ALM Investments). The successful candidate will have the opportunity to work directly with senior portfolio managers and PNC’s CIO.
The ideal candidate will have in-depth knowledge and experience trading in various fixed income investment products, preferably Rates and/or liquid trading products such as swaps, swaptions, futures and futures options, Treasuries, STRIPS, TIPS, and mortgage-backed securities.
Additionally, the candidate will have a well-rounded skill-set that includes programming/statistical capabilities (preferably with market research and trading applications), experience with valuation and risk modeling for fixed income products, balance sheet and deposit modeling, finance and accounting knowledge, interpersonal skills for working within a team atmosphere, project management experience, and the ability to provide practical solutions for improving investment performance and risk management.
Potential areas of focus may include (and will be highly visible within the firm):
1) Rates Trading and Research
a. Rates portfolio trading (e.g. swaps, UST, STRIPS, TIPS), derivatives hedging (debt issuance, asset swaps, cash flow hedges), mortgage servicing rights hedging
b. Bank securities and derivatives portfolio: risk, returns, and attribution tracking
c. Trade idea generation and construction
2) Bank balance sheet modeling, risk/analytics, returns performance, and trading/hedging strategies
3) LIBOR fallback and SOFR transition; primarily for derivatives but coordinated throughout all banking products and asset classes
4) Hedge accounting strategies for derivatives (latest FASB rule updates, regression testing, ineffectiveness accounting)
5) Deposits modeling
6) Funds Transfer Pricing
7) OTC and Futures clearing
8) Regulatory and Compliance: Volcker rule, derivatives reporting, internal investment policy documentation, etc.
9) CCAR/DFAST stress testing
10) Model validation and documentation
